How do giant businesses optimize IT-pushed processes? incessantly through hiring administration consultants to forged an skilled eye over digital traceries and ship recommendations for making improvements to core operations like logistics and production.
but Munich-based totally B2B SaaS startup Celonis reckons device can do a greater job of flagging up areas the place there’s room for industry optimization.
Its tool integrates with around 60 current endeavor-level business management IT systems — together with systems from SAP, Oracle, Microsoft, Salesforce.com and ServiceNow — processing customers’ knowledge in real time to generate suggestions for reinforcing industry performance. it might probably also plug into legacy techniques, normally using a partner firm to do the implementation in these cases. the only requirement is that a customer is the use of IT systems to manage their industry methods.
Celonis describes what its device does as a brand new sub-set class of big-information mining, known as course of mining. “It’s a new kind of giant knowledge analytics,” says co-founder and CEO Alexander Rinke. “We didn’t invent it, we just found out about it very, very early.”
One instance he provides of the roughly trade process intelligence it is generating for buyers could be that sending a particular standard customer support response steadily results in callbacks — due to this fact implying the solution is not clear enough and that process needs to alter.
Celonis shoppers are also using the device to optimize procurement procedures — possibly picking out invoicing problems with particular vendors, or issues with outsourcing prices particularly places. Accounting, customer service and e-commerce are different areas of focal point for applying the tool, he provides.
“What we do is we work out these are the tactics, these are the orders which went well. and then these are people who took longer, which had extra interactions — so extra folks worked on it and so on. So what’s the difference within the construction? Is it the vendor? Is it the client? Is it the branch place of job? Is it the country that produced the goods?” he says.
“so as to level the company to — out of these 15 million cases [for example], these are the 5 areas where that you can enhance. because we see a giant choice of transactions going the unsuitable way.”
Celonis claims it’s been in a position to give a boost to operational effectivity for its shoppers with the aid of between 20 and 30 %. It trains its customers to use the device but will not be offering consulting products and services on top of its SaaS — slightly, it grants them with the software that generates a dashboard view of how their business is functioning so they may be able to determine what to do to make stronger general business effectivity. The software additionally offers a sub-set of focal point area suggestions, in response to the data it has crunched.
“provide chain is [another] big house,” provides Rinke. “It is dependent a bit of bit on the trade but i’d say provide chain, manufacturing, procurement. i would by no means have believed sooner than beginning this how big of an issue the entire procurement operation is, especially for higher companies.”
Celonis was based again in 2011 after the three co-founders, who met at the Technical college of Munich, had been engaged on a school challenge with an area media company that needed assist optimizing the efficiency of its IT lend a hand desk operation.
“They gave us the information. the entire logs, the whole lot, and said… okay tell us how to reinforce. What we did is we used visualization technology, we used data mining technologies, we used the whole lot lets in finding in the marketplace to crunch this knowledge — and what we really ignored out on is k we now have 20 groups on this IT provider operation, how do they work collectively, where are they losing time… We lacked an actual insightful prognosis of the process,” he says, explaining how the theory for the startup was once born.
fast-ahead to lately and Celonis has more than 200 buyers across 15 industries in 25 nations — together with international Fortune 500 companies equivalent to Siemens, KPMG, Deloitte, Bayer and Vodafone, plus a range of mid-sized shoppers. final 12 months it additionally signed a worldwide reseller agreement with SAP, which is combining its course of mining tech with its personal in-memory database, SAP Hana.
Celonis can also be working with some administration consultancy firms, in step with Rinke, who sees it now not as killing off the traditional administration consultant but perhaps shifting what these individuals do.
“There can be some projects they gained’t do anymore because we can automate a lot of it,” he suggests. “alternatively there shall be new issues that they are going to do — more than likely much more. we’re even taking part with some, so have a variety of the consultants, like Deloitte, KPMG, Roland Berger, McKinsey, are even our buyers. And use our product.”
Areas the place Celonis’ software can’t assist business effectivity are components of a business where there’s no step-by-step IT course of involved, such as inventive strategies. “the whole lot the place it’s slightly creative than transactional” is how Rinke sums up what’s outdoor its attain.
“I wouldn’t say that we substitute the rest, I’d say that we supply buyers new possibilities — it’s like sooner than you used Google, you went into a library. however Google doesn’t truly exchange the library… it just offers you a new way to get knowledge. And what i admire to consider Celonis is we provide firms a brand new method to take into account how they may be able to improve,” he provides.
Celonis been earnings-generating and successful for multiple years — despite the fact that it’s not breaking out revenue at this stage (however will say it grew around four,000 p.c over that period) — but is now asserting its first external funding, pulling in a $ 27.5 million sequence A spherical led through Accel and 83North.
It’s planning to use the financing to ramp up its operations in markets such as the U.S. Its primary markets at this stage are Germany and Europe, according to Rinke, with what he dubs a “rising presence” in Benelux and the U.okay.
“especially in the us we wish to make investments rather a lot in building the market out there, and in addition making our know-how even better and rising the worth for our current and new customers even further,” he tells TechCrunch. “Our primary focus is really growing the class and building our marketing and sales operation global.”
So why take VC funding now, having successfully bootstrapped the business to profitability due to the fact 2011? Rinke flags up what he dubs the “essential possibility” to get expertise and data from the investors in query on scaling an endeavor tech firm globally as one key motivation, along with eyeing the wider opportunity he believes is accelerating down the process mining pipe.
“We grew four,000 p.c in the final 4 years, and are very profitable, so we could have persisted that direction on the other hand we predict that this funding offers us with two things: 1), a number of expertise, because the buyers have repeatedly been fascinated by corporations that became pretty large and went IPO,” he says, adding: “The second aspect is we consider it provides a lot of strategic flexibility and we see… the advantage of course of mining accelerating so much.”
